Job Summary
Follow production instructions from process sheets, blueprints, or supervisor directions to achieve desired manufacturing outcomes. Install machine fixtures by aligning and securing dies, punches, and blades for safe operation. Set up and operate lathes, mills, drills, presses, and CNC machines per specifications. Monitor production to ensure correct machine function and product quality, performing inspections with calipers, micrometers, and gauges to verify tolerances. Adhere to safety protocols, wear PPE, and use a crane or buddy system for heavy parts while maintaining a clean work area. Work Monday through Friday, 7:30 AM to 4:00 PM.
